Ruzicka is waiver eligible, but I don't think he clears waivers.
- drogon


I think he probably would if he's sent down because he's not playing well enough to be on the team. Remember, making a waiver claim isn't just a free player. You have to keep that player on the roster, you have to have a free contract slot, and you lose your spot in the waiver line. They're all minor headaches, but probably enough for teams to question whether putting in the claim is worth it.
